 Cannot connect to SQL Server after installing Windows XP Service Pack 2 on the server
 Windows XP Service Pack 2 (SP2) includes a new component, Windows Firewall. The default settings of Windows Firewall prevents other computers from connecting to services on the Windows XP computer, including the SQL Server service.

 SQL Server Instances
 Q. How many instances of SQL Server 2000 can be installed on a computer? A: The maximum number of instances supported in SQL Server 2000 is 16. The number of instances that can run on a single computer depends on available resources. Q. What are default
